Betty Storey Obituary

Betty Kay Storey, 84, of Arkansas City, KS, passed away on Friday, January 24, 2020 at South Central Kansas Medical Center of Arkansas City.

Funeral Services will be held at 10:00 A.M. on Thursday, January 30, 2020 at Shelley Family Funeral Home of Arkansas City.  Burial will follow at Ninnescah Cemetery, south of Udall, KS.  A visitation will be from 12:00 noon to 8:00 P.M. on Wednesday with the family present from 6:00 – 8:00 P.M. that evening at the funeral home.  A memorial has been established with Relay for Life of Arkansas City.  Contributions may be made through the funeral home.   

Betty was born at home in rural Udall, KS on July 22, 1935 the daughter of Albert V. and Edith Elaine (Effner) Holmes.  She attended Udall High School. On March 19, 1951, she was united in marriage to Francis H. Storey in Clark County, Texas.  Betty worked at Peerless Bakery in Winfield for a time.  She retired after 32 years with Binney & Smith Crayola Factory.

Betty was a member of the Udall United Methodist Church and the Binney & Smith 25 Year Club.  She enjoyed gardening, flowers, arts and crafts and loved her children, grandchildren and great-grandchildren very much.

Her family includes her daughter, Deb Hargrove and husband Larry of Arkansas City, her son, Randy Storey and wife Rebecca of Udall, KS, her son-in-law, Wallace Deffenbaugh of Derby, KS; her sister, Allene Kistler and husband Roy of Udall, KS, her brother, Ray Stephen Holmes of Udall, KS, her grandchildren, Amy and Brent Pinion, Arkansas City, Matthew Llamas of Arkansas City, Amber Llamas and fiancé Jeremy Samson of Arkansas City, Tim Hargrove and wife Miranda of Arkansas City, Megan Voyles and husband Eric of Wichita, KS, Andrew Storey and wife Allie of Andover, KS; her great-grandchildren, Allison, Braydon and Brody Pinion, Lauren and Paige McPherson, Kelsey and Kyanna Llamas, Jamee Gigliotti, Jayda Redelman, Macie Voyles, Jace and Norah Storey.  She was preceded in death by her parents and husband, brother, Barry Holmes, daughter, Lavonna Deffenbaugh and great-granddaughter, Lillian McPherson.
